В тестах TPC-H появилась интересная система от Kickfire, заняв достаточно высокое место в тесте на 300Gb . Немного присмотревшись, появилось надежда, что кто-то наконец придумал что-то новенькое в мире DBMS. Kickfire это реляционная субд, где часть функционала оптимизатора выполняется в неком SQL-чипе, а другая часть является MySQL:
MySQL provides:
● connectivity
● security
● administration
Kickfire software provides:
● optimizer
● column store and cache
● transactional engine
SQL Chip provides:
● SQL execution
● memory management
● loader acceleration
Судя по всему SQL-чип втыкается в PCI-E слот, имеет собственную память и берет на себя выполнения некоторых реляционных операторов, к примеру берет на себя выполнение джоинов. Выглядит, что принцип похож на 3D чипы в видеокартах, которые берут на себя операции со множествами которые процессоры общего назначения выполняют не так успешно. Сторадж система также своя - колоночная (напоминает Sybase IQ). Мысль конечно не сильно новая, специализированное MPP железо для субд не редкость, но дешевые чипы, на дешевых x86 серверах, да еще и c MySQL обвязкой вполне способны устроить небольшой прорыв.